THIS IS NOT A SOLICITATION.  The Naval Air Warfare Center Aircraft Division (NAWCAD) is seeking additional sources for engine starters in accordance with MIL-S-22999B, Starter, Aircraft Engine, Hydraulic, for listing on Qualified Products List (QPL) 22999.  MIL-S-22999B is available at ASSIST https://quicksearch.dla.mil/ and may be obtained by using the "Document Number" search box and entering 22999.

These hydraulic starters will start aircraft turbine engines.   Engine requirements are specified in specification sheets MIL-S-22999/1 (for T58 turbine engine) and MIL-S-22999/2A (for T64 turbine engine) available at ASSIST. Type I starters will be designed to operate as part of a dual-pressure, nominal 3000 and 4000 psi hydraulic system. Type II starters will be designed to operate as part of a nominal 4000 psi flow-limited hydraulic system. More details are provided in 1.2.1 of the specification.

THIS IS NOT A SOLICITATION.  With respect to products requiring qualification, awards will be made only for products that are, at the time of award of contract, qualified for inclusion in QPL-22999 whether or not such products have actually been so listed by that date.  Contractors should be aware of requirements specified in MIL-S-22999B. Manufacturers should arrange to have the products that they propose to offer to the Federal Government tested for qualification in order that they may be eligible to be awarded contracts or orders for the products covered by MIL-S-22999B.  Guidance for manufacturers and their authorized distributors who wish to submit products for NAWCAD qualification is available from the Provisions Governing Qualification (SD-6).  The SD-6 is available at ASSIST, https://quicksearch.dla.mil/ (enter SD-6 in the “Document ID” search box).    Additional information and questions pertaining to qualification of products to MIL-S-22999B may be obtained from rose.webster@navy.mil.
